❶ 用下列晶元構成存儲器系統,需要多少個RAM晶元需要多少位地址用於片外地址解碼設系統有20位地址線。
1.需要晶元:(16k/512)*(8/4)=64 ; 9+2=11;
2 (256/64)*(8/1)=32 ; 6
3 (128k/1024)*(8/1)=1024; 10
4 (64k/2k)*(8/4)=64 11+2=13
❷ 用容量為16K x 1位存儲器晶元構成一個32K x 8 位的存儲系統,需要多少根地址線多少根數據線
需要5根地址線和2根數據線。而且需要2*8個16K x1存儲器。
16Kx1到32Kx8,字數和字長都變化了,也就是綜合兩種拓展方法拓展。16K到32K是兩倍,使用非門作為解碼器(1線-2線),故需要兩個存儲晶元。
構成存儲器的存儲介質主要採用半導體器件和磁性材料。存儲器中最小的存儲單位就是一個雙穩態半導體電路或一個CMOS晶體管或磁性材料的存儲元,它可存儲一個二進制代碼。由若干個存儲元組成一個存儲單元,然後再由許多存儲單元組成一個存儲器。
注意事項:
分類:
cf快閃記憶體卡:一種袖珍快閃記憶體卡。像pc卡那樣插入數碼相機,它可用適配器,使之適應標準的pc卡閱讀器或其他的pc卡設備。
sd快閃記憶體卡:存儲的速度快,非常小巧,外觀和MMC一樣,市面上較多數數碼相機使用這種格式的存儲卡。
數字膠卷:一種數碼相機的存儲介質,同日立的sm卡、松下的sd卡、索尼的memorystick屬同類的數字存儲媒體。
❸ 現用 sram2114存儲晶元組成存儲系統,試問採用線選解碼時需要多少個2114存儲
共需要16根片選線24等於16所要4-16解碼器解碼器輸入址線4根輸片選信號線16根,除片選要加入使能功能擴展5-32解碼器(貌似像沒5輸入解碼器通加線兩端端變端取反再4-16解碼器聯合起使用實現功能)
❹ 用容量為16K*1位存儲器晶元構成一個32K*8位的存儲系統
16K x1到32K x8,字數和字長都變化了,也就是綜合兩種拓展方法拓展。
*字數拓展
16K到32K是兩倍,使用非門作為解碼器(1線-2線),故需要兩個存儲晶元
*字長拓展
將上面拓展作為整體看成一個存儲器,從1位到8位,是八倍。採用並聯,輸入都一樣,需要8個存儲器(已經字數拓展過的存儲器)
經過兩次拓展,需要2*8個16K x1存儲器
❺ 用下列晶元構成存儲系統,各需要多少個RAM晶元需要多少位地址作為片外地址譯
碼?設系統為20位地址線,採用全解碼方式。解:(1)512*4位RAM構成16KB的存儲系統; 需要16KB/512*4=64片;片外地址解碼需11位地址線。
❻ 在有16位地址匯流排的微機系統中,採用8K*4位存儲器晶元,構成32KB的存儲器系統
1)要用8K*4位晶元2片,組成8K*8位,此看作一組晶元,片選信號;
那麼構成32KB的存儲器系統,就需要4組晶元,及4個片選信號;
2)8k的定址范圍為 2^13 = 8192,所以該晶元的地址線為 A12A11A10...A1A0,共13根;
3)因為有4組晶元,所以還需要2根高位地址線A14A13來產生片選信號;
而16位的地址匯流排中,還剩餘A15,為避免地址重復,可置A15=0(或者=1)的;
4)採用74LS138來產生片選信號,分配如下:
A15A14A13---對應74LS138的CBA輸入;
0 0 0 -- Y0 (定址范圍:0--8192)
0 0 1 -- Y1 (定址范圍:8193--16384)
0 1 0 -- Y2 (定址范圍:16385--24576)
0 1 1 -- Y3 (定址范圍:24577--32768)
❼ 用下列晶元構成存儲系統,各需要多少個RAM晶元需要多少位地址作為片外地址譯
碼?設系統為20位地址線,採用全解碼方式。解:(1)512*4位RAM構成16KB的存儲系統; 需要16KB/512*4=64片;片外地址解碼需11位地址線。 (2)1024 * 1位 RAM構成 128KB的存儲系統; 需要128KB/1K*8=1024片;片外地址解碼需10位地址線; (3)2K * 4位 RAM構成 64KB的存儲系統; 需要64KB/2K * 2=64片;片外地址解碼需 9位地址線;
❽ 用下列晶元構成存儲系統,各需要多少個RAM晶元需要多少位地址作為片外地址譯
先說明一下外地址解碼的問題,設系統為20位地址線,所以本身的RAM的地址線+外地址=20
所以
(1)512=2^9,地址線9位,外地址線11位
(2)1024 =2^10,地址線9位,外地址線10位
(3)2K =2^11,地址線9位,外地址線9位
(4)64K =2^16,地址線9位,外地址線4位
再看片的問題,其實也簡單,
64K * 1位 RAM構成 256KB的存儲系統 ;前面是RAM的大小,所以所以形成256KRAM時,只要用256/64=4
256KB/64K * 8位,這兒的8是怎麼回事呢,數據是用一個位元組表示的,一個位元組為8位,所以數據線要8位,它和地址線沒有關系,這兒是固定的,(以後的系統中就不一定是8位了),所以用8/1=8,所以就成了
256KB/64K * 8
第一題的是*2不是4
❾ 存儲晶元的組成
存儲體由哪些組成
存儲體由許多的存儲單元組成,每個存儲單元裡面又包含若干個存儲元件,每個存儲元件可以存儲一位二進制數0/1。
存儲單元:
存儲單元表示存儲二進制代碼的容器,一個存儲單元可以存儲一連串的二進制代碼,這串二進制代碼被稱為一個存儲字,代碼的位數為存儲字長。
在存儲體中,存儲單元是有編號的,這些編號稱為存儲單元的地址號。而存儲單元地址的分配有兩種方式,分別是大端、大尾方式、小端、小尾方式。
存儲單元是按地址尋訪的,這些地址同樣都是二進制的形式。
MAR
MAR叫做存儲地址寄存器,保存的是存儲單元的地址,其位數反映了存儲單元的個數。
用個例子來說明下:
比如有32個存儲單元,而存儲單元的地址是用二進制來表示的,那麼5位二進制數就可以32個存儲單元。那麼,MAR的位數就是5位。
在實際運用中,我們 知道了MAR的位數,存儲單元的個數也可以知道了。
MDR
MDR表示存儲數據寄存器,其位數反映存儲字長。
MDR存放的是從存儲元件讀出,或者要寫入某存儲元件的數據(二進制數)。
如果MDR=16,,每個存儲單元進行訪問的時候,數據是16位,那麼存儲字長就是16位。
主存儲器和CPU的工作原理
在現代計算中,要想完成一個完整的讀取操作,CPU中的控制器要給主存發送一系列的控制信號(讀寫命令、地址解碼或者發送驅動信號等等)。
說明:
1.主存由半導體元件和電容器件組成。
2.驅動器、解碼器、讀寫電路均位於主存儲晶元中。
3.MAR、MDR位於CPU的內部晶元中
4.存儲晶元和CPU晶元通過系統匯流排(數據匯流排、系統匯流排)連接。
❿ 由存儲晶元構成存儲器時,怎樣確定需要多少晶元
確定晶元數量的方法:
晶元數量≥存儲器容量/存儲晶元容量。比如構成32K存儲器模塊,需要4K×8晶元的數量是:
n≥(32K*8)/(4K*8)=8片,所以選擇8片即可。
存儲器是現代信息技術中用於保存信息的記憶設備。其概念很廣,有很多層次,在數字系統中,只要能保存二進制數據的都可以是存儲器;在集成電路中,一個沒有實物形式的具有存儲功能的電路也叫存儲器,如RAM、FIFO等;在系統中,具有實物形式的存儲設備也叫存儲器,如內存條、TF卡等。